In the present work, the removal of lead and cadmium, metals highly hazardous to humans and the environment, from a standard solution using bovine bone as a natural adsorbent is presented. Bone is mainly constituted by calcium apatite known as hydroxyapatite (HAP), which is a transparent-translucent solid and poorly soluble in water. The ionic character of PAH [Ca10(PO4)6(OH)2], gives it the capacity for partial or complete substitution of network ions by others of similar size. The main objective is to develop a simple and effective technique to help prevent and remediate the contamination of aquifers with heavy metals such as lead and cadmium.
